Abstract

The application discloses a power system for a hydrofoil plate and an electric hydrofoil plate, and relates to the technical field of hydrofoil plates. The power system comprises a mast assembly and a power assembly; a first end of the mast assembly is provided with a first connecting part; the power assembly comprises a fuselage, the two ends of the fuselage are respectively provided with a front hydrofoil and a tail wing, and a connecting groove is formed in the fuselage; the connecting groove is a through groove, the first connecting part is arranged to be detachably inserted into the connecting groove in a plug-in mode, and the two ends of the first connecting part are tightly combined with the two sides of the connecting groove. The application achieves the following technical effects: the front hydrofoil and the tail wing at the two ends of the fuselage provide upward lift, the two ends of the first connecting part are pressed upward from the two sides of the connecting groove, the first connecting part can be stably fixed in the connecting groove, the mast assembly and the power assembly are convenient to install and detach, and sufficient connection stability can be ensured, and the problem that the mast part and the power part of the hydrofoil plate are difficult to install and detach in the prior art is solved.

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of hydrofoil, in particular to a power system for hydrofoil. BACKGROUND

[0002] The power supply line and the signal line of the power part of the current powered hydrofoil are connected to the main control board of the mast part through welding or switching, and the mast part is difficult to install and disassemble. In order to facilitate disassembly and use, the power part and the mast part are set as a split structure in the related technology, which connects the other part by opening a mounting groove on the power part or the mast part, and the connector in the mounting groove is arranged to realize electrical connection. However, since the power part needs to be operated underwater for a long time, the stress is complex, and the simple use of the mounting groove to realize the connection of the two parts will result in poor connection stability, so additional locking members (such as screws) are needed to increase the connection stability, resulting in that the installation and disassembly are still inconvenient. [0052] In the embodiment, the power system cooperates with the plate body to form an electric hydrofoil plate, and the power system mainly comprises the mast assembly 1 and the power assembly 21. The mast assembly 1 is substantially a vertical rod structure, the upper end of which is connected with the plate body, and the lower end of which is connected with the power assembly 21. The main body structure of the power assembly 21 is a fuselage 4, and the two ends of the fuselage 4 are arranged with a front hydrofoil and a tail wing 7. When used as an electric hydrofoil plate, the fuselage 4 is arranged with a motor and a propeller 6, and the propeller 6 is located close to the tail wing 7. The propeller 6 is rotated by the motor to provide thrust, so that the front hydrofoil and the tail wing 7 generate lift under the action of water flow.

[0053] For easy carrying and use, the mast assembly 1 and the power assembly 21 are detachably connected in the embodiment. Specifically, as shown in Figure 2 and Figure 3As shown, the first connecting part 3 is arranged at the lower end of the mast assembly 1 by opening a connecting groove 5 on the fuselage 4, and the first connecting part 3 and the connecting groove 5 are matched by insertion. During installation, the first connecting part 3 is inserted into the connecting groove 5. In order to ensure sufficient connection stability of the mast assembly 1 and the fuselage 4 after connection and reduce the installation of additional locking members, the connecting groove 5 is arranged as a through groove in this embodiment, and the front hydrofoil and the tail wing 7 are arranged at both ends of the fuselage 4. It should be noted that the connecting groove 5 in this embodiment is a through groove, which means that the connecting groove 5 is open in the width direction and has side walls in the length direction matched with both ends of the first connecting part 3.

[0054] The front hydrofoil and the tail wing 7 arranged at both ends of the fuselage 4 are used to provide lift to make the fuselage 4 deform upward, and the deformation will act on both sides of the connecting groove 5 to make both sides of the connecting groove 5 press the both ends of the first connecting part 3 towards the middle. The connecting groove 5 is arranged as a through groove to make it easier to press the first connecting part 3 towards the middle under the action of the lift. If the connecting groove 5 is a groove closed on all sides, it is not conducive to the deformation of the connecting groove 5, and even if it deforms, the both sides of the connecting groove 5 in the length direction will press the first connecting part 3 towards the middle during the deformation, but the both sides in the width direction will separate from the first connecting part 3 due to the pressing force, and the both sides in the width direction will be difficult to recover after the deformation, resulting in a decrease in the connection strength of the first connecting part 3 and the connecting groove 5.

[0055] Therefore, the connecting groove 5 is arranged as a through groove in this embodiment, and the front hydrofoil and the tail wing 7 arranged at both ends of the fuselage 4 are used to generate lift to compress the first connecting part 3, thereby improving the connection strength of the mast assembly 1 and the fuselage 4. Due to the improvement of the connection strength, additional locking members can be considered not to be used or the number of locking members can be reduced after installation, which is convenient for installation and disassembly.

[0081] ​In the embodiment, the first connection port 18 and the second connection port 15 constitute the connector of the mast assembly 1 and the fuselage 4, and there is a contact impedance between the two. If the connection device is unreliable, the contact impedance is too large during operation, which can easily cause the temperature of the part to be too high, which can affect the charging power output, or even cause the connector to lose control of heat, causing a safety accident. If the connection port is worn during long-term plugging, the connection port may not be fully plugged, which can cause the impedance at the connection to be too large, and thus the temperature of the connection port to be too high. To solve the problem of overheating of the connector, a temperature protection device is usually used, which includes a temperature detection and control circuit. In the selection of the connector and the temperature detection scheme, the difficulty is how to balance the cost of the connector and the safety problem of the temperature detection circuit and the high-voltage circuit. The existing solution is to fix the plug-in temperature sensor on the connector shell by heat-conducting glue. The connector shell is usually made of plastic. This method has two problems. First, the selection of the connector is limited, and the cost is relatively high. Second, the production process is complex, and the temperature sensor and the connector need to be glued and fixed

[0082] Therefore, the power assembly 21 in the embodiment further includes a temperature sensor (not shown in the figure), which is arranged close to the second connection port 15 and used to detect the temperature at the connection between the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18.

[0083] Specifically, it should be noted that the temperature sensor can be welded to the position close to the second connection port 15 on the electronic speed controller board 20 to detect the temperature at the connection between the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18. Alternatively, the temperature sensor and the electronic speed controller board 20 can be connected by wires, so that the position of the temperature sensor is more flexible, and the temperature sensor can be kept at a safe distance from the connection port while being as close to the heat source as possible, so that the specific temperature of the connection port can be obtained more accurately.

[0084] In another embodiment, since the contact impedance will increase when the connection is unreliable, the voltage and / or current of the connection port can also be detected to determine whether the voltage and / or current is within a preset normal threshold or a preset normal threshold range, so as to determine whether the connection port has a connection abnormality problem.

[0085] Specifically, in the embodiment, the power assembly 21 further includes a current / voltage detection module (not shown in the figure), which is used to detect the current and voltage of the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18.

[0086] In another embodiment, the connection of the connection port can also be judged by a sensor for position detection to determine whether the connection has a connection abnormality. Specifically, the power assembly 21 further comprises a position detection sensor (not shown in the figure) arranged on the fuselage 4 and / or the mast assembly 1, for detecting the relative position of the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18.

[0087] For example, the connection of the connection port can be judged by a Hall sensor. When the Hall sensor detects a change in the magnetic field, it can be determined that the current connection of the connection port is abnormal, when the magnetic field reaches a preset threshold or the range of the magnetic field change exceeds a preset range value. For another example, the connection of the connection port can be judged by infrared. An infrared receiving (or sending) end is arranged in the first connection port 18 (or the second connection port 15), and a corresponding infrared sending (or receiving) end is arranged in the second connection port 15 (or the first connection port 18). If the infrared receiving end cannot receive the infrared light sent by the corresponding infrared sending end, it can be determined that the current two connection ports have a connection abnormality.

[0088] When it is determined that the connection of the connection port has an abnormality by the above method, a prompt information can be sent to prompt the user. For example, an abnormality prompt can be made on a remote controller in communication connection with the hydrofoil board to control the hydrofoil board.

[0089] Further, the power system further comprises a main control system 2 and a power supply system (not shown in the figure), the main control system 2 and the power supply system are electrically connected, and the main control system 2 is electrically connected with the electronic speed controller assembly through the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18. In one embodiment, the main control system 2 is arranged at the upper end of the mast assembly 1, and the power supply system is arranged in the board body of the hydrofoil board. As shown in the figure, the main control system 2 is detachably connected with the second connection part 22 on the mast assembly 1, and is detachably electrically connected with the power supply system, and is electrically connected with the electronic speed controller assembly (the electronic speed controller board 20) in the fuselage 4 after the first connection port 18 and the second connection port 15 are docked. Figure 1

[0090] The detachable electrical connection of the first connection part 3 and the power supply system can be realized by an electrical connector, and the connection and disconnection can be realized by plugging. It can be understood that the connection of the first connection part 3 and the power supply system can also use the connection and cooperation of the first connection port 18 and the second connection port 15 in the above embodiment, and this embodiment will not be described again.

[0091] ​In the prior art, the user needs to turn off the power supply before disassembling the mast assembly 1 and the power assembly 21 through the plugging and unplugging of the connection port, so as to disassemble the power assembly 21 and avoid the danger of sparking caused by hot plugging (plugging under power). However, in many cases, the user directly performs hot plugging, and turning off the power supply before disassembling the power assembly 21 needs to turn the hydrofoil over back and forth, which is cumbersome for the user and has a poor experience.

[0092] Therefore, the present application can further automatically turn off the power supply at the moment when the user performs hot plugging by detecting the board or the connection port, so as to avoid sparking during the plugging and unplugging process of the user, that is, to realize "hot plugging" from the user experience.

[0093] In an embodiment, the power system for the hydrofoil further comprises a posture detection sensor (not shown in the figure), such as a gyroscope, which is used to detect the posture of the board. When the posture of the board is in a set posture, the posture detection sensor sends an electrical signal to the main control system 2, and the main control system 2 controls the power supply system to be powered off after receiving the electrical signal.

[0094] Since the user needs to turn the board over during the plugging and unplugging process in most cases, the posture detection sensor can send an instruction to the main control system 2 when it detects that the board has been turned over to a preset posture, and the main control system 2 turns off the power supply system based on the instruction.

[0095] In another embodiment, the power assembly 21 further comprises a position detection sensor (not shown in the figure), which is arranged on the fuselage 4 and / or the mast assembly 1 and is used to detect the relative position of the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18.

[0096] When the relative position of the second connection port 15 and the first connection port 18 is in a set position, the position detection sensor sends an electrical signal to the main control system 2, and the main control system 2 controls the power supply system to be powered off after receiving the electrical signal.

[0097] Specifically, a sensor for position detection can be arranged at the connection port to determine whether the connection of the connection port is in a disengaged state, and when it is determined that the connection of the connection port is in a disengaged state, an instruction can be sent to the main control system 2 to make the main control system 2 control the power system to be turned off, so as to avoid sparking during user plugging, i.e. to achieve "hot plugging" from the user experience. For example, when the Hall sensor detects a change in the magnetic field, i.e. the magnetic field reaches a preset threshold or the magnetic field change range exceeds a preset range value, it can be determined that the connection of the current connection port is in a disengaged state, and an instruction can be sent to the main control system 2, and the main control system 2 responds to the instruction to turn off the power. Similarly, the connection state of the main control system 2 can also be determined by infrared.

[0098] Preferably, the scheme of detecting the posture and detecting whether the connection of the connection port is in a disengaged state can be combined. If it is detected that the board body is flipped to a preset posture, and it is determined that the connection of the connection port is in a disengaged state, an instruction can be sent to the main control system 2 to make the main control system 2 control the hydrofoil board to turn off the power, so as to improve the accuracy of the determination and avoid power off caused by false triggering.
